What types of materials are expelled from cells during exocytosis?
Question 8 options:

large molecules such as hormones

positive and negative ions

small molecules such as carbon dioxide

water and glycerol

Respuesta :

petersonbailey1 petersonbailey1
  • 23-01-2020

Answer:

Large molecules such as hormones

Explanation:

The other options either have channels within the membrane to move through (water has aquaporins, ions like potassium have their own channels) or can diffuse directly through the membrane (CO2). Protein hormones cannot move through the plasma membrane, nor can they diffuse through it. Hope this helps!
